Lesson Explanation

Comparatives compare two things; superlatives identify the extreme within a group of three or more.

Short adjectives (one syllable) add -er and -est:

tall → taller → the tallest big → bigger → the biggest (doubling the consonant)

Long adjectives (two or more syllables) use more and the most instead of changing the word itself:

beautiful → more beautiful → the most beautiful

Several common adjectives are genuinely irregular and must be memorized directly:

good → better → the best bad → worse → the worst
